> Thanks for letting me know if good linux image stitching software > exists. I appreciate hearing from anyone who has done image --> movie > projects like this and what they used? i have never used it for this purpose, but have you considered using imagemagick? it would stich all the pngs into one (something like convert +append image1 image2 ... imagen output.png) and then chop it up into a zillion pieces with geometries differing by a pixel or 5 (something like convert -crop -geometry XxY+Z+Q output.png 1.png; convert -geometry XxY+(Z+1)+Q). all command line and iterable. you'd end up with a zillion similar images that when appended into a movie looked like panning, i think. _______________________________________________ PLUG mailing list [email protected] http://lists.pdxlinux.org/mailman/listinfo/plug
